Common Names | E: Emigdio’s Ground Snake |
Synonym | Atractus emigdioi GONZÁLEZ-SPONGA 1971 Atractus emigdioi — VANZOLINI in PETERS & OREJAS-MIRANDA 1986: 2 Atractus emigdioi — KORNACKER 1999: 63 Atractus emigdioi — WALLACH et al. 2014: 72 Atractus emigdioi — PASSOS et al. 2024: 79 |
Distribution | Venezuela (Trujillo, Mérida)) Type locality: Campamento MOP., 19 km de Bocono en la via Bocono-Trujilo, Estodao Trujilo, Venezuela. |
Reproduction | oviparous |
Types | Holotype: MCNC 5629, a 415 mm female (E. Gonzáles Sponga, 20 Aug. 1971). Paratypes. Eight specimens: MCNC 5630, 5632 and ULA‐ BG 3791 (formerly MCNC 5631) and five additional individuals housed in the private collection of the M.A. Gonzaléz‐Sponga (MAGS 364, 365, 367, 368 and 374), with same data as the holotype. As the González‐Sponga arachnid’s collection (after his death in 2009) was transferred to the Museo del Instituto de Zoología Agrícola of the Universidad Central de Venezuela (see Huber and Villareal, 2020), we assume that these paratypes of Atractus emigdioi are also currently housed in such collection. |
